India vs South Africa Live Cricket Score, ICC Champions Trophy 2013 match: India beat South Africa by 26 runs

India begin their Champions Trophy campaign with a 26-run win over South Africa. Indian spinners were impressive. Ravindra Jadeja, Ravichandran Ashwin and Suresh Raina were impressive. For South Africa Ryan McLaren top scored with an unbeaten 71. AB de Villiers scored 79 while Robin Peterson scored 68. South Africa were keeping up with the required run-rate but during a crazy middle phase they lost quick wickets. The momentum was lost. A couple of needless run-outs pegged back South Africa considerably.
